Mysql postavke

Osigurajte se da su sljedeće linije aktivirane negdje u vašoj apache2.conf datoteci (ili u vašoj conf.d/php.ini):

# extension=php_mysql.so

Tako da postane

extension=php_mysql.so

Konfiguracijska datoteka mysqla je pod: /etc/mysql/my.conf

Standardno mysql kreira korisnika, koji radi bez lozinke. Da promijenite root lozinku:

mysql> USE mysql;
mysql> UPDATE user SET Password=PASSWORD('new-password') WHERE user='root';
mysql> FLUSH PRIVILEGES;
Kreiranje korisnika

Ne morate nikada koristiti root lozinku, tako da morate kreirati korisnika koji se spoji s mysql bazom podataka za PHP skript. Alternativno možete dodati korisnike u mysql bazu podataka s kontrolnim okvirom kao phpMyAdmin da lagano kreirate ili odredite priviligije za bazu podataka za korisnike.

Da uđete u web interface upišite sljedeće u vaš web browser:

http://ipaddress/phpmyadmin/

Kad ste pitani za korisničko ime i lozinku upišite root kao korisničko ime za bazu podataka i upišite lozinku (standardno ne postoji lozinka za root korisnika za bazu podataka)

Izvor:

http://www.mysql-apache-php.com

http://httpd.apache.org/docs/1.3/misc/security_tips.html

http://www.debianhelp.co.uk/webserver.htm

Content last revised 18/10/2007 0410 UTC